The Job:

As a Business Development Manager, you’ll be part of our Tools and Outdoor Commercial team working as a remote employee. You’ll be responsible for increasing the sales of PROTO, Stanley, , Lenox and DEWALT brands marketed and sold through our National Accounts partners in the Industrial channels. You will take full ownership of the Sales Cycle, which includes identifying needs, presenting solutions, execution, forecasting, POS review and working with SBD Industrial team members. You will be expected to continuously review/understand the competitive landscape to secure proper Channel Position. You will be responsible for new item recommendations, presentations, POS/Scorecard Analysis, and managing all discretionary budgets.  You’ll also get to:   

  • Manage, grow, and develop a relationship with key verticals within distribution partners designated to support and represent the total breadth of Stanley Black & Decker industrial solution brands: DeWalt, Stanley, Lenox, Proto, Irwin.
  • Demonstrate the value of Stanley Black & Decker’s total product portfolio and services by identifying target opportunities, running product trials, and providing the customer with a cost savings analysis report to show the difference between value and price.
  • Identifying key national opportunities with distribution partners to attack with the use of promotions, programs, and new products.
  • Manage administrative aspects and timely reporting for all territory management areas, including Expense Management (travel and samples), paperwork, forecasts, gap plans, upside opportunities, and other requests from leadership. 
  • Keep distributors motivated and informed about product and keeping sales personnel focused on technical services as important value-added service when selling.
  • Create and present a value-based method of communication with distribution and end users.
  • This position involves approximately 30%-40% travel within territory. Local and overnight travel within territory to support distributor / customer needs and growth.  Travel for National Distributor Meetings and Industry Trade Shows as needed
  • Coordinate relationship efforts between Industrial Account Managers, distribution, end-users and yourself
  • Meet and Exceed POS Sales Goals for National Accounts.
  • Execute on BDT plans for new product introductions at National Accounts, coupled with a plan to execute new product national promotional programming with independents as applicable.
  • Review business with customer on a monthly/quarterly basis to ensure growth targets being achieved.
  • Properly document in CRM all account and contact information, call activity, and conversion opportunity progression.
  • Take credit for value added activity by highlighting that activity to distributor / end user with the appropriate documentation.
  • Provide support to distributor partners and end-users on product training through educational and safety seminars.
  • Utilize national promos, flyers, resources, and events regionally to develop a relationship with distribution.
